Rainer Koppitz Becomes CEO & MD of BT’s Business in Germany & Austria

BT has appointed Rainer Koppitz to the position of CEO and Managing Director for its business in Germany and Austria, succeeding Nina Wegner who will move on to her new role as Vice President, Strategic Transformation Europe in BT Global Services. She will remain on the board of BT Germany as Managing Director and will continue to support the German team with the management of key customer relationships.

Rainer Koppitz brings with him 25 years’ experience in the IT and telecommunications industries. He joins BT from NFON, a leading provider of cloud-based IP telephony solutions, which he led as CEO. Rainer also boasts vast experince in IT services, outsourcing, and systems integration, having led Dell’s IT services business in EMEA and having held various senior management positions in Siemens. 

Rainer Koppitz will lead these operations to ensure they fully leverage opportunities in future growth areas such as IT services, cloud computing, security, and unified communications & collaboration, said a statement by BT. 

BT serves around 1,000 customers in Germany and Austria, including two-thirds of the top German (DAX30) companies and some of the largest banks, insurance companies, chemical companies and technology groups. BT operates an extensive high-performance network infrastructure in Germany with its own metropolitan area networks in four key cities and three state-of-the-art data centres across the country.
